Craniomaxillofacial Implants Market Overview

Craniomaxillofacial Implants Market size is estimated at USD 3186.76 million in 2026 and is expected to reach USD 6084.74 million by 2035 at a 7.45% CAGR.

The Craniomaxillofacial Implants Market is experiencing significant expansion due to the increasing prevalence of facial trauma, congenital deformities, cranial reconstruction procedures, and advanced maxillofacial surgeries worldwide. Craniomaxillofacial implants are widely used in the treatment of skull fractures, jaw reconstruction, orbital floor repairs, and facial bone stabilization. More than 20 million people globally suffer facial injuries annually, creating sustained demand for craniomaxillofacial implants across hospitals and specialty surgical centers. Titanium-based implants account for over 60% of implant usage due to their strength and biocompatibility. The Craniomaxillofacial Implants Market is witnessing rapid technological transformation through the integration of 3D printing, digital surgical planning, and personalized implant manufacturing. More than 45% of advanced healthcare institutions are utilizing computer-aided design technologies to improve implant precision and surgical outcomes. Customized implants have demonstrated fitting accuracy exceeding 90%, reducing surgical adjustment requirements during procedures.

Another major trend shaping the Craniomaxillofacial Implants Market Research Report is the growing adoption of bioresorbable fixation systems. These implants account for nearly 25% of pediatric craniofacial procedures due to their ability to eliminate secondary removal surgeries. CHALLENGE

"Managing Implant Complications and Clinical Standardization"

One of the most significant challenges affecting the Craniomaxillofacial Implants Market is ensuring consistent clinical outcomes while minimizing complications. Implant-related infections remain a concern in reconstructive surgeries, with infection rates ranging between 2% and 10% depending on procedure complexity. Long-term implant stability and compatibility must be continuously monitored, especially in complex cranial reconstructions. Variations in surgical techniques across healthcare facilities create challenges for standardization and outcome measurement. Furthermore, patient-specific implants require highly accurate imaging and manufacturing workflows, where minor deviations may affect implant performance. The lack of universal treatment protocols across regions can also complicate adoption decisions. Plates: Plates account for nearly 24% of total implant utilization, making them one of the most commonly used product categories in the Craniomaxillofacial Implants Market. These devices provide rigid fixation for cranial and facial fractures and are essential in maintaining anatomical alignment during healing. Studies indicate that more than 70% of maxillofacial trauma procedures utilize fixation plates. Titanium plates dominate usage due to their high strength and corrosion resistance. Technological advancements have led to thinner and anatomically contoured plate designs that improve patient comfort and surgical outcomes. The demand for low-profile fixation systems has increased by approximately 40% among surgeons seeking reduced palpability and improved cosmetic results. Plate systems are widely used across trauma, orthognathic surgery, tumor reconstruction, and congenital deformity correction procedures, ensuring continued market expansion.

Screws: Screws contribute nearly 16% of the Craniomaxillofacial Implants Market and are critical components in fracture stabilization and implant fixation procedures. More than 80% of craniofacial surgeries involving plates require specialized screws for secure placement. Self-drilling and self-tapping screw technologies have gained widespread adoption, reducing surgical time by nearly 20%. Surgeons increasingly prefer advanced screw systems that provide stronger fixation while minimizing bone damage. The growing number of trauma surgeries and reconstructive procedures globally continues to increase screw demand. Enhanced biomechanical performance and compatibility with customized implant systems have expanded their applications across cranial reconstruction and facial fracture management. Continuous innovation in screw design, including improved thread geometry and reduced insertion force requirements, supports long-term market growth.

BY APPLICATION

Titanium: Titanium dominates the Craniomaxillofacial Implants Market with approximately 68% share due to its exceptional strength, corrosion resistance, and biocompatibility. More than two-thirds of craniofacial reconstruction procedures utilize titanium-based implants because they provide long-term stability and excellent osseointegration. Clinical studies indicate implant success rates exceeding 95% in many reconstructive applications. Titanium plates, screws, meshes, and customized implants are extensively used in trauma repair, orthognathic surgery, and cranial reconstruction. The material's lightweight nature and compatibility with advanced manufacturing techniques support growing adoption of patient-specific implants. Surgeons favor titanium because it withstands significant mechanical stress while maintaining structural integrity. Continuous advancements in surface treatment technologies and additive manufacturing processes further enhance performance characteristics. The widespread use of titanium across healthcare systems continues to strengthen its leadership position within the Craniomaxillofacial Implants Market.

Polymer: Polymer-based implants account for approximately 32% of the market and are gaining considerable traction due to their flexibility, radiolucency, and customization potential. These implants are widely used in cranial reconstruction, pediatric procedures, and situations where imaging compatibility is essential. Polymer materials can reduce implant weight by more than 40% compared to some traditional alternatives. Advanced polymer formulations offer excellent biocompatibility while enabling highly precise anatomical customization. More than 35% of patient-specific cranial implants are now produced using advanced polymer materials. The segment benefits from increasing demand for personalized medicine and minimally invasive reconstruction approaches. Improved manufacturing technologies have enhanced durability and structural performance, expanding application possibilities.
